WebTune a ported subwoofer box to a specific frequency with the following equation: Fb = the desired tuning frequency of the enclosure in Hertz. Lv = the length of your port in inches. R = the inside radius of your vent tube. Vb = the internal volume of your enclosure in cubic inches. To convert cubic feet to cubic inches, multiply by 1728. WebFor this reason, they can usually handle more power in these frequency ranges than ported designs and dual-reflex bandpass designs, which makes them less prone to low-frequency induced speaker damage. At frequencies below the tuning frequency of the port, a woofer in a ported box (or a dual-reflex bandpass) starts to de-couple.
